How they compare

Poland currently reports 17.48 million 1000 Int$ against 15.47 million 1000 Int$ in New Zealand, a difference of 2.01 million 1000 Int$.

That makes Poland's figure about 1.1 times New Zealand's.

The two have swapped places 8 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Poland ahead.

New Zealand ranks 19th and Poland ranks 18th of 195 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, New Zealand averaged higher in 2 and Poland in 5.

Head to head by decade

Decade New Zealand Poland Difference Ahead
1960s 7.35 million 1000 Int$ 10.88 million 1000 Int$ 3.53 million 1000 Int$ Poland
1970s 8.53 million 1000 Int$ 13.96 million 1000 Int$ 5.43 million 1000 Int$ Poland
1980s 9.86 million 1000 Int$ 14.20 million 1000 Int$ 4.34 million 1000 Int$ Poland
1990s 10.38 million 1000 Int$ 12.70 million 1000 Int$ 2.32 million 1000 Int$ Poland
2000s 12.72 million 1000 Int$ 12.72 million 1000 Int$ 70 1000 Int$ New Zealand
2010s 14.69 million 1000 Int$ 14.60 million 1000 Int$ 93,420 1000 Int$ New Zealand
2020s 15.46 million 1000 Int$ 16.67 million 1000 Int$ 1.21 million 1000 Int$ Poland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
